Overview of the Suzuki 40HP 4-Stroke Outboard
The Suzuki 40HP 4-stroke outboard (Model DF40A) represents a major benchmark in lightweight, fuel-efficient marine propulsion. Built around a high-torque 941 cc inline three-cylinder engine block, this mid-range outboard delivers the perfect balance of immediate hole-shot power and quiet, vibration-free trolling for skiffs, pontoon boats, and aluminum fishing craft.
Equipped with Suzuki’s multi-point sequential electronic fuel injection (EFI) and signature Lean Burn technology, the Suzuki 40HP 4-stroke outboard ensures quick turn-key starting, instant throttle response, and maximum fuel economy across all operating speeds.
Technical Specifications
- Model Year: 2014
- Horsepower: 40 HP
- Engine Type: Inline 3-Cylinder, DOHC 12-Valve
- Displacement: 57.4 cu. in. (941 cc)
- Fuel Delivery: Multi-Point Sequential Electronic Fuel Injection (EFI)
- Starting System: Electric Start
- Shaft Length Options: 15 in. (Short Shaft) / 20 in. (Long Shaft)
- Full Throttle RPM Range: 5300 – 6300 RPM
- Weight: Approx. 229 lbs (104 kg)
- Gear Ratio: 2.27:1
- Alternator Output: 19 Amp
- Trim & Tilt: Power Trim and Tilt
Performance Features of the Suzuki 40HP 4-Stroke Outboard
Suzuki Lean Burn Control System
The core advantage of choosing a Suzuki 40HP 4-stroke outboard is its Lean Burn Control System. By monitoring real-time operating conditions, the engine computer calculates the precise air-to-fuel mixture required, allowing the motor to run efficiently on a leaner air mixture without overheating or dropping horsepower.
Self-Adjusting Timing Chain
Unlike conventional engines that rely on rubber timing belts requiring regular inspection and replacement, this Suzuki 40HP 4-stroke outboard features an internal, self-adjusting timing chain running in an oil bath. This lowers routine maintenance overhead and drastically improves long-term reliability.
High-Output 19-Amp Alternator
To power modern marine electronics, GPS units, and livewell pumps, this motor integrates a 19-amp charging system that delivers high current even when trolling at low RPMs.
Corrosion Defense & Saltwater Protection
- Anti-Corrosion Finish: Suzuki applies a specialized surface finish directly over the high-grade aluminum alloy block to prevent salt oxidation.
- Dual Flushing Ports: Built-in freshwater flushing ports make clearing salt, silt, and sand simple after a day on the water.
- Galvanic Protection: Strategically located sacrificial zinc anodes shield the internal water passages and lower gear casing from galvanic corrosion.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
What battery is recommended for the 2014 Suzuki 40HP 4-stroke outboard?
A standard 12-volt marine starting battery with a minimum rating of 650 Marine Cranking Amps (MCA) or 512 Cold Cranking Amps (CCA) is recommended to properly energize the electronic fuel injection system and starter motor.
What type of engine oil should I use in this motor?
Use an SAE 10W-40 or 10W-30 FC-W certified 4-stroke marine engine oil. FC-W certification guarantees the oil contains special anti-corrosion and anti-wear additives necessary for harsh marine environments.
Does the Suzuki 40HP 4-stroke outboard require oil mixing with fuel?
No. As a true 4-stroke engine, oil is stored in a separate internal sump. Fill the fuel tank with standard unleaded gasoline (minimum 87 octane, maximum 10% ethanol/E10).
What is the dry weight of the DF40A?
The motor weighs approximately 229 lbs (104 kg), making it one of the lightest engines in the 40 horsepower class.
